Why join Beit Ahavah?

  • We are a progressive and inclusive spiritual community, welcoming members from all backgrounds. Beit Ahavah offers a warm and supportive spiritual home.
  • We participate in Shabbat and holiday services that are spiritual, musical and meaningful.
  • We offer a dynamic child education program, Bat/Bar Mitzvah preparation, and innovative adult education. Our programs integrate the arts into learning and community building.
  • We cherish all generations within our community and provide activities and services that meet the needs of our diversified mix of young families, dynamic adults and seniors, and empty nesters.
  • We offer members opportunities for social action and tikkun olam, healing the world.
  • We provide the opportunnity to be part of a vibrant and growing Reform Jewish community.

The benefits to membership include access to all Beit Ahavah services and events; life cycle events facilitated by our rabbi, Riqi Kosovske; tickets to High Holiday services; receipt of Reform Judaism magazine; access to our community school; and opportunities for adult education.

Regarding dues, Beit Ahavah does not want financial considerations to be an obstacle for membership in its community. We are committed to welcoming all participants, regardless of ability to pay - no one will ever be turned away due to lack of funds. However, please remember that Beit Ahavah relies on its members for financial survival. The financial support payments of our members, even at their current levels, do not cover the full operating costs of the community. We therefore ask that you consider making the greatest payment you can, and we encourage members who feel they can afford to do so to make Sponsor Support Contributions above the basic levels.

Payment Schedules

Members can elect to pay their 2008-2009 dues in one payment by July 31, can spread the payments out over three periods -- 50% due on July 31, and 25% due on each of October 15 and February 15, or can pay in installments by credit or debit card.

Dues payments and contributions to Beit Ahavah are fully tax-deductible. We will send you a statement in January notifying you of all tax-deductible payments made to Beit Ahavah during the calendar year. Only payments made prior to December 31 will be eligible to qualify for tax deductibility for tax-year 2008.

Please call the office at 587-3770 if you would like to request a dues abatement or arrange other payment terms.
